TCC employee injured in Odesa while checking documents

In Odesa, a man stabbed a serviceman with a knife during a document check and fled the scene. The victim was taken to the hospital, and the incident was recorded on camera.

This was reported by the press service of the Odesa Regional Trade and Commerce Center and JV.

The Odesa Regional Training and Production Center has officially confirmed the fact of an attack on a serviceman that took place in the evening of September 16, 2025, in the Kyiv district of Odesa. According to the agency, a joint group consisting of a representative of the National Police and servicemen of the territorial center was conducting warning activities. During this, one of the citizens was asked to show his military registration documents.

Instead of complying with the request, the man began to run away, after which he committed an armed attack - using a knife and inflicting a penetrating wound to the serviceman. After the crime, the offender fled the scene.

The wounded serviceman was immediately taken to a medical facility where he is being provided with all necessary assistance. According to the CCC, there is currently no threat to life, but the victim's condition requires further treatment.

The incident was recorded on the soldier's body camera. The recording, along with other materials, will be handed over to law enforcement agencies to document the crime and conduct procedural actions.

The TCC and JV emphasized that the use of weapons against military personnel performing tasks in accordance with the law is a serious criminal offense that falls under a number of articles of the Criminal Code.

This is not the first time that conflicts between citizens and TCC employees have occurred. In early September, investigators brought a case of theft of a company car to court: A 43-year-old man got into a car that was supposed to take another citizen for an examination at the MEC, and despite the presence of the driver, he suddenly jumped behind the wheel and drove off.

The Odesa CCM and JV also commented on the video of the incident on Dalnytska Street, where a group of soldiers pushed a civilian into a windowless cargo van. The video shows the man resisting, and eyewitnesses are outraged. The department said that during the alert, unauthorized civilians began to aggressively interfere and use force against the military.
